Output 65d4ef326f9379f5de0b4a7fc9e87497e34fb17de6adda31c6b5c0bb173ee971:0

value
1492398000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11e8fe4bdbe16cdf9c23f8d779f62ee79c0bb4bf OP_EQUALVERIFY OP_CHECKSIG
address
12dhbvWQfYzBqKPPcShk3r9VuMrqteAXj9
transaction
65d4ef326f9379f5de0b4a7fc9e87497e34fb17de6adda31c6b5c0bb173ee971
confirmations
737788
spent
true